About Dr. Peery....
Drawing upon three decades of work as a teacher, administrator, instructional
coach, author, and consultant, Dr. Angela Peery successfully partners with fellow
educators to optimize outcomes for all students.
Dr. Peery has worked with scores of schools and districts all over the United States,
in addition to Canada and Australia, to improve teaching and learning. Her
experience includes working in rural, suburban, and urban environments as well as
with high-performing schools and those that are under strict sanctions for
low performance.
